Job Description
Technical Experience: Expertise in .NET Technologies, C#, ASP.NET, .NET Core, OOP, and Python for Web and GenAI solutions. Develop dynamic, responsive UI components using Angular (16-19). Implement state management with NgRx, Akita, or Signals. Write clean, modular TypeScript, JavaScript, HTML5, CSS, using Angular/React Material, Bootstrap, or Tailwind CSS. Ensure cross-browser compatibility, responsiveness, and optimized UI performance. Integrate REST APIs and WebSocket's for real-time applications. Design and implement RESTful APIs and microservices using ASP.NET Core. Implement authentication & authorization with OAuth2, JWT, or Identity Server. Hands-on with Web API, gRPC, and scalable API design. Work with Entity Framework Core, SQL Server, and database programming (procedures, functions, triggers). Experience with RabbitMQ or Kafka for event-driven architectures. Optimize backend performance and ensure high availability. Cloud and DevOps: Deploy applications on Azure , AWS, or GCP Build CI/CD pipelines using GitHub Actions , Azure DevOps , or Jenkins Work with Docker and Kubernetes for containerization and orchestration Extensive Azure PaaS experience: Azure AD, App Services, Azure SQL, Functions, Key Vault, Logic Apps, Service Bus, Event Hub, Blob Storage, CDN . GenAI & Orchestration: Knowledge of AI orchestration SDKs: LangChain, DeepAgent, Microsoft Agent Framework , Prompt Engineering. Integrate GPT4/GPT5 models into .NET using Microsoft Semantic Kernel . Implement function/tool calling , schema validation, and structured output enforcement to reduce hallucinations. Expertise in RAG architecture : embeddings, vector search (Azure AI Search, Pinecone, pgvector), reranking, metadata filtering. Developer Productivity & Tooling: Proficient with GitHub Copilot (IDE/CLI/PR review) for code generation, testing, and standards compliance. Build custom Copilot agents for automated PR triage and secure coding enforcement. Hands-on with MS SQL Server, Visual Studio 20